Output e7bd641894c9cb2dfd067ff87b3c7747956b5d044a9a7d651e0878b675913587:1

value
66555525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6904581aff52cfa4b12a13581fa787a09eda3bd OP_EQUAL
address
3MFXMknW8MKuB24F8ZaDpE89oQjcKefGnY
transaction
e7bd641894c9cb2dfd067ff87b3c7747956b5d044a9a7d651e0878b675913587
spent
true